KVC Acquires Mission Nurseries

Kolaboration Ventures Corporation and Mission Nurseries Inc. announced they have concluded a definitive Agreement pursuant to which KVC has acquired all of the issued and outstanding shares of Mission Nurseries Inc.

Key Transaction Highlights and Benefits

  • Strategic Products & Product Development – Mission Brands’ products are loved by tens of thousands of California cannabis consumers across hundreds of dispensaries. This includes Canna-LeanTM, MyBlueDoveTM, BuzziesTM, Don PrimoTM, White WidowTM, Black WidowTM, Comfort CBDTM, NitecapzzTM, Happy DazeTM, and Mission NurseriesTM.
  • Market share leader in KVC Enjoythefarm.com retail locations  – Products are in the top products for every category they compete within.
  • Product Development – Mission Brands SOPs for emulsification and productization enable us to further expand the products and categories their products compete in.

Balanced Economics

  • Increased scale and diversification – Adding Mission Brands to the portfolio further bolsters and diversifies KVC’s revenue base with higher-value SKUs.
  • Improved revenue mix – The acquisition furthers KVC’s goal of increasing vertical integration and scale to drive profitability improvement.

Management Commentary

“We are incredibly excited to announce this acquisition. KVC brings increased fuel to drive continued product innovation of the Mission Brands product portfolio while furthering the KVC goal of delivering high-quality cannabis products at affordable prices while increasing margin,” said Martin Wesley, CEO of Kolaboration Ventures Corporation.

“Since our founding, our mission has been to deliver high-quality cannabis products at fair prices to our customers, the opportunity to better achieve our goal led us to joining the KVC family. Kolaboration Ventures continues to expand its retail and cultivation footprint, which furthers our efforts to reduce COGs while increasing product availability to continue to deliver incredibly popular products that consumers love,” said Mitchell Davis, CEO of Mission Brands.
